Bag-1在大鼠缺血预处理肝胆管中的表达及意义

Expression of Bag-1 in bile duct of ischemic preconditioning rats and its significance

摘要 目的研究缺血预处理对大鼠缺血再灌注损伤肝内胆管上皮细胞凋亡及Bag-1表达及影响,探讨IP对IR损伤后胆管上皮细胞凋亡的保护作用及其可能机制。方法健康雄性SD大鼠30只,随机分为假手术组(SO组)、缺血再灌注组(IR组)、缺血预处理组(IP组),每组10只。制备IR及IP模型,取肝门周围组织行免疫组化、原位杂交染色检测Bag-1基因和蛋白的表达及行TUNEL染色检测胆管上皮细胞凋亡并计算凋亡指数(AI)。结果TUNEL染色显示胆管上皮细胞凋亡水平SO组最低、IR组最高、IP组居中,三组两两比较均有统计学意义。免疫组化染色及原位杂交染色Bag-1mRNA和蛋白在各组中的表达程度与TUNEL染色提示的凋亡程度相同,且两两比较有统计学意义。结论缺血预处理对胆管上皮细胞具有保护作用,可能与上调Bag-1mRNA和蛋白的表达有关。 Objective To explore the effect of ischemic preconditioning(IP) on apoptosis and expression of Bag-1 mRNA and protein in bile duct cells of ischemia-reperfusion(IR) injury. Methods Thirty SD rats were randomly divided into sham operation group(SO group,n=10),IR group(n=10) and IP group(n=10).The liver orthotropic ischemic reperfusion model was established according to Chien's method.TUNEL technique,hybridization in situ and immunohistochemistry were used to determine apoptotic index and the expression of Bag-1 mRNA and protein,respectively. Results Compared with SO group,apoptosis of biliary epithelial cell increased in IR group.Apoptosis of biliary epithelial cell was significantly lower in IP group than in IR group(P〈0.05).Compared with SO group,expression of Bag-1 mRNA and protein in biliary epithelial cell increased in IR group (P〈0.05) and IP group (P〈0.01). Conclusion The protective effect of ischemic preconditioning can be implemented by up-regulating the expression of Bag-1 mRNA and protein in biliary epithelial cell.
